Goethite and pyrite are common iron minerals in oxic or anoxic environments, respectively, both minerals being major reservoirs for Nickel, a bio-essential element. Mineral transformation between goethite and pyrite is frequent owing to the alternation of oxic and anoxic conditions in sulfate-rich environments.

In Brazil, iron ore with a high grade of goethite (FeOOH) (LOI > 3.5%), independent of its Fe grade, is considered marginal because goethite causes excessive mud generation in the wet processing step, which is very harmful in flotation (slime coating phenomena) and filtration (blinding) operations. The para-goethite iron removal process is one of the several pptn. processes used today to remove iron from zinc-rich processing solns. The para-goethite process is compared with results obtained from a study of the similar Zincor process.
